If your skills, experience, and qualifications match those in this job overview, do not delay your application.Founded in 2009, Reformation is a revolutionary lifestyle brand that proves fashion and sustainability can coexist. We combine stylish, vintage-inspired designs with sustainable practices, releasing limited-edition collections for individuals who want to look beautiful and live sustainably. Setting an example for the industry, Reformation remains at the forefront of innovation in sustainable fashion—running the first sustainable factory in Los Angeles, using deadstock and eco fabrics, tracking and sharing the environmental impact of every product, and investing in the people who make this revolution possible. The brand has also established itself as a pioneer in retail innovation, developing an in-store tech concept that brings the best of its online experience to its physical doors.We are a future focused organization committed to the belief that the problems facing our planet and society can be solved through innovation, common sense and education. We build an inclusive culture together and make a real impact along the way.Technical Design ManagerReformation is looking for an awesome Technical Design Manager who will link the design department and production to ensure that all designs translate to amazing garments. The role reports to the Director of Technical Design & Quality. The role includes overseeing your product category(s), leading the fit process from design to production, establishing and maintaining fit standards, generating clear detailed fit comments to vendors, managing the technical design workflow for the category, and mentoring any assisting staff.
